In suburban areas like Castle Pines, collisions can happen anywhere—commuter corridors, neighborhood intersections, and parking areas tied to everyday errands. What makes hit-and-run claims especially time-sensitive here is that key evidence is frequently lost fast:
- Home and business camera systems may overwrite footage after a short retention window.
- Dashcam footage can be overwritten if the recording loop isn’t saved immediately.
- Witness memories fade—particularly when people are trying to get back to work, school, or evening schedules.
- Vehicle identification details (partial plate digits, vehicle color, distinctive damage patterns) can be hard to recall accurately days later.
In Colorado, waiting can also complicate how insurers view causation and the seriousness of injuries. The sooner you document what happened, the better your case is positioned.
